.item-wrapper:where(.astro-rtaeqj7m){align-items:center;display:flex;gap:.75rem;width:100%}.item-wrapper:where(.astro-rtaeqj7m) p{font-size:14px;line-height:1.5}@media(min-width:1024px){.item-wrapper:where(.astro-rtaeqj7m) p{font-size:16px;line-height:1.5}}.item-wrapper:where(.astro-rtaeqj7m) a{text-decoration-line:underline;text-underline-offset:2.5px}:where(.astro-rtaeqj7m)[data-icon]{font-size:18px;line-height:1.3}@media(min-width:1024px){:where(.astro-rtaeqj7m)[data-icon]{font-size:20px;line-height:1.2}}:where(.astro-rtaeqj7m)[data-icon]{color:rgb(var(--color))}.wrapper:where(.astro-2xzqby2i){align-items:flex-end;display:flex;flex-direction:column;gap:1.5rem;width:100%}@media(min-width:640px){.wrapper:where(.astro-2xzqby2i){background-color:#2a262fd9;border-bottom-left-radius:1.5rem;border-top-right-radius:1.5rem;padding:1.25rem 1.25rem 2.5rem;--tw-shadow:0px 13px 27px -5px rgba(0,0,0,.25),0px 8px 16px -8px rgba(0,0,0,.3);--tw-shadow-colored:0px 13px 27px -5px var(--tw-shadow-color),0px 8px 16px -8px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 #0000),var(--tw-ring-shadow,0 0 #0000),var(--tw-shadow)}}@media(min-width:768px){.wrapper:where(.astro-2xzqby2i){padding-left:1.5rem;padding-right:1.5rem}}@media(min-width:1024px){.wrapper:where(.astro-2xzqby2i){gap:1.75rem;padding:1.75rem 2rem 3rem}}@media(min-width:1280px){.wrapper:where(.astro-2xzqby2i){padding-left:3.5rem;padding-right:3.5rem}}.tag:where(.astro-2xzqby2i){background:var(--tag);border-radius:.125rem;font-weight:600;height:-moz-fit-content;height:fit-content;letter-spacing:.02em;padding:.25rem 1.5rem;text-shadow:1px 1px 0 rgba(0,0,0,.9);width:-moz-fit-content;width:fit-content}.desc:where(.astro-2xzqby2i),.tag:where(.astro-2xzqby2i){font-size:14px;line-height:1.5}.desc:where(.astro-2xzqby2i){text-wrap:pretty;width:100%}@media(min-width:768px){.desc:where(.astro-2xzqby2i){font-size:16px;line-height:1.5}}.list-wrap:where(.astro-2xzqby2i){display:grid;gap:1rem;grid-template-columns:repeat(1,minmax(0,1fr));width:100%}@media(min-width:1024px){.list-wrap:where(.astro-2xzqby2i){gap:1.25rem}}.list-wrap:where(.astro-2xzqby2i) h2:where(.astro-2xzqby2i){font-size:18px;font-weight:600;line-height:1.3;width:100%}@media(min-width:768px){.list-wrap:where(.astro-2xzqby2i) h2:where(.astro-2xzqby2i){font-size:20px;line-height:1.2}}.list-wrap:where(.astro-2xzqby2i) ul:where(.astro-2xzqby2i){-moz-column-gap:1.25rem;column-gap:1.25rem;display:grid;grid-template-columns:repeat(1,minmax(0,1fr));row-gap:.75rem;width:100%}@media(min-width:768px){.list-wrap:where(.astro-2xzqby2i) ul:where(.astro-2xzqby2i){grid-template-columns:repeat(2,minmax(0,1fr))}}@media(min-width:1280px){.list-wrap:where(.astro-2xzqby2i) ul:where(.astro-2xzqby2i){-moz-column-gap:1.5rem;column-gap:1.5rem}}.ctas:where(.astro-2xzqby2i){display:grid;gap:.75rem;grid-template-columns:repeat(1,minmax(0,1fr));width:100%}@media(min-width:640px){.ctas:where(.astro-2xzqby2i){gap:1rem;grid-template-columns:repeat(2,minmax(0,1fr));padding-top:.75rem}}@media(min-width:1024px){.ctas:where(.astro-2xzqby2i){gap:1.25rem}}.cta:where(.astro-2xzqby2i){border-radius:9999px;border-width:1.5px;width:100%;--tw-border-opacity:1;border-color:rgb(251 250 251/var(--tw-border-opacity,1));font-size:14px;font-weight:600;line-height:1.5;padding-bottom:.375rem;padding-top:.375rem;text-align:center;transition-duration:.3s;transition-property:color,background-color,border-color,text-decoration-color,fill,stroke,opacity,box-shadow,transform,filter,backdrop-filter;transition-timing-function:cubic-bezier(.4,0,.2,1)}.cta:where(.astro-2xzqby2i):hover{--tw-bg-opacity:1;background-color:rgb(251 250 251/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(37 33 43/var(--tw-text-opacity,1))}article:where(.astro-4cy6ccft){background-repeat:no-repeat;background-size:cover;padding-left:6%;padding-right:6%;width:100%}@media(min-width:640px){article:where(.astro-4cy6ccft){padding-left:5.1%;padding-right:5.1%}}@media(min-width:1280px){article:where(.astro-4cy6ccft){padding-left:0;padding-right:0}}.content-wrapper:where(.astro-4cy6ccft){display:grid;gap:3.5rem;height:100%;margin-left:auto;margin-right:auto;max-width:59.75rem;min-height:100dvh;padding-bottom:3rem;padding-top:1.75rem;width:100%}@media(min-width:640px){.content-wrapper:where(.astro-4cy6ccft){padding-top:2rem}}@media(min-width:768px){.content-wrapper:where(.astro-4cy6ccft){padding-top:2.5rem}}@media(min-width:1024px){.content-wrapper:where(.astro-4cy6ccft){gap:5rem;padding-bottom:4rem}}@media(min-width:1280px){.content-wrapper:where(.astro-4cy6ccft){padding-top:3.5rem}}.content-wrapper:where(.astro-4cy6ccft){grid-template-rows:auto 1fr}